**Alert: ConfigHotReloadFailed**

This alert fires when Marrowgate fails to apply a hot-reloaded configuration within 30 seconds of a change being published. The service keeps running on the last known-good config, so customer impact is usually delayed rather than immediate — but subsequent restarts may pick up the broken values. Check the validation errors in the reload log first, and confirm whether the change was intentional. Detailed triage steps are maintained on the page below.

runbook for badug-kadup: https://confluence.zemvarlabs.internal/projects/browse/display/projects/bd1b

ALERT: Rate-parity drift — Fairlode checker. The Fairlode scraper found the Wrenmoor channel quoting rates more than 5% below contracted parity for 40+ properties. Likely cause: stale promo feed, not a contract breach. Do not notify hotel partners yet — confirm the feed timestamp first. Triage checklist, channel contacts, and the suppression procedure for false positives are on the internal page below.

operations page: https://vault.qorvelcorp.example/settings

## Service Accounts — Rotava Secrets Utility

Rotava rotates credentials for internal services on a 30-day cycle. It runs under the svc-rotava account, which holds write access to the vault namespace and nothing else. Contractors: never invoke Rotava manually against production; use the dry-run flag in staging first. To bootstrap Rotava itself, it needs one seed credential for the internal vault API, namely this one.

app token of badug-tahaf = qvz11-nP5FBNr8qnh

**Checklist — Off-site run: medical coolers, Larkspur field clinic**

- [ ] Pull the four Frostbine coolers from the chilled store and check each temperature logger is running before they leave the dock.
- [ ] Top up gel packs — the run to the Larkspur field clinic takes about three hours, so don't skimp.
- [ ] Keep coolers upright and strapped; no stacking other freight on top.
- [ ] Log departure time on the shift sheet.

When the courier arrives, follow the hand-over instruction below.

handover note for yagef-bagep: the drudor pelius courier leaves the kasdor zorvan norir ledger at gate 8016 under passcode 755406